The value of integral ∫xn-1sin(xn)dx is: (where n is an integer)

Put x^n = t
Hence
n* x^(n-1) dx = dt
Now
x ^(n-1) dx = dt/n
Then your question becomes as
Sin t dt/n
On integrating
Answer is
(1/n)(-cos t) + C
Now put the value of t
Hence final anwer will be
(1/n) ( -cos (x^n)) + C
